Set of 2 Iconic Black Stained MZO Dining Chairs in Beechwood by Mazo Design
Located in Geneve, CH
Set of 2 Iconic Black Stained MZO Chairs in Beechwood by Mazo Design Dimensions: W 46 x D 50 x H 75 cm Materials: Beech. This iconic chair played a leading role in one of the fairy tales of Danish furniture design. However – more curiously – it is also on display at The Workers Museum in Copenhagen. This chair was designed specifically with the ambition to create a chair that working class Danes could afford. With mazo's new edition this classical chair is once again made available to everyone looking for a quality dining chair. Pare of Rare Side Chairs in Oak by Hans J. Wegner
By Johannes Hansen, Hans J. Wegner
Located in Lejre, DK
Pair of side chairs model no. JH504 in patinated pine and cane. Designed by Hans J. Wegner M.A.A for Johannes Hansen in 1950. Great condition.

Pair of George III Scottish Mahogany Side Chairs
Located in London, GB
A PAIR OF GEORGE III SCOTTISH MAHOGANY SIDE CHAIRS, CIRCA 1760. Provenance: made for Sir John Clerk, Penicuik House, Midlothian and thence by descent at Penicuik.
